How Search Engine Optimization Helps Small Businesses Compete in Qatar

0
117

 

Big brands have a budget. Small businesses have a focus. Search Engine Optimization gives that focus a megaphone. When people in Qatar search for a café near West Bay, a clinic in Al Wakrah, or a plumber in Lusail, the results they see first often win the click. With the right steps, you can show up where it matters and turn searches into steady customers.

Why Search Engine Optimization levels the field

Most buying journeys start with a question. “Best mandi near me.” “Same day flower delivery Doha.” If your pages answer those questions clearly, you earn visibility without buying every visit. Search Engine Optimization helps your site match what people type, so you attract visitors who already want what you sell. It is not about tricking the system. It is about being the best result for the search.

Local intent wins in Qatar

People search with a place in mind. Add accurate addresses, opening hours, and phone numbers to your site and keep Google Business Profile up to date. Collect real photos and short reviews from customers. Use neighborhood words that locals say in conversation, not just formal district names. These simple moves tell search engines you serve Doha, Lusail, Al Rayyan, and beyond, which boosts your chance to appear for “near me” moments.

Bilingual Search Engine Optimization that reads naturally

Qatar is bilingual. Create Arabic and English pages that feel equal in tone and layout. Do not just translate; adapt. A dish name, service term, or cultural reference may differ by language. Use clean right to left support and mirrored layouts where needed. When both versions read smoothly, people stay longer and engage more, which sends positive signals back to search.

Speed, mobile, and clear navigation

Most visitors are on phones. Slow pages cost money. Compress images, keep menus short, and show the next step without scrolling too far. A fast site with simple paths lowers bounce and raises conversions. Search engines notice. It is a quiet edge that helps Search Engine Optimization work harder across every page.

Content that answers, not just advertises

Write like you talk to a customer in your shop. Explain prices plainly. List services with short benefits. Add a quick FAQ based on the questions you hear most. A restaurant might share delivery zones and minimum order amounts. A clinic might outline appointment steps and accepted insurance. Useful content keeps people on the page and builds trust.

Smart use of location pages

If you serve multiple areas, create one helpful page per location. Include the map, parking notes, nearby landmarks, and a few local photos. Do not clone the same text. Give each page a reason to exist. These pages support Search Engine Optimization by matching specific searches like “tailor in Msheireb” or “IT support Lusail Marina.”

Links that grow from real relationships

You do not need hundreds of links. You need a few good ones. Partner with nearby businesses, sponsor a school event, or join a local directory that people actually use. When relevant sites point to you, search engines read it as a vote of confidence. Keep it natural and local; quality beats quantity.

Reviews and reputation signals

Ask happy customers for short, honest reviews in Arabic or English. Reply to each one with a thank you and a detail that shows you read it. These words add fresh, keyword rich signals you did not have to write yourself. They also help shoppers decide faster, which lifts the value of your Search Engine Optimization work.

Measure what matters

Track a few numbers you can act on: visits from Doha or Lusail, calls and messages from your profile, and the pages that lead to orders or bookings. If a service page gets visits but no contact, improve the offer, add a price range, or move the button higher. Small edits can unlock big gains.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Writing for algorithms instead of people

  • Using stock text across every page

  • Hiding prices and contact details

  • Ignoring Arabic layout and language nuances

  • Letting hours, menus, or services go out of date

The business effect you will notice

Calls and messages come from closer, higher intent customers. Walk-ins say “I found you on Google.” Delivery routes get denser. You spend less to acquire each sale because Search Engine Optimization keeps bringing the right people to your door.
